Stress Management
Acute stress is body’s immediate reaction to a significant threat, challenge or scare. It is the fight-or-flight response. It is the function of ANS- Autonomic Nervous System. On the other hand, chronic stress is a state of ongoing physiological arousal. Research and studies believe. The more we get stressed, fewer solutions we get. Through learning self-hypnosis, train your body to be more in Parasympathetic drive, which the state of Rest & Digest, that boosts immune, digestive and reproductive system. And so, it improves the functioning of ‘Higher Brain Problem Solving’ and reduces stress.
